Tour opener ends in a draw for NZ cricketers

6:21 am on 10 August 2009

The New Zealand cricketers have drawn their Sri Lankan tour opener against a Development side in Colombo.

The Black Caps were unable to pick up the last 4 local wickets as they finished on 257 for 6 chasing 335 to win.

Despite being unable to take the win the captain Daniel Vettori was pleased overall with an solid workout with both bat and ball - and the chance to acclimatise to local

conditions.

Best of the New Zealand bowlers on the final day were Jacob Oram with 3 for 32 off 12 overs, Vettori with 2 for 69 and Jeetan Patel with 1 for 74.

The BlackCaps play another three-day tour match against a Sri Lankan eleven in Colombo, starting on Wednesday.

The first Test of the series starts next Tuesday at Galle.
